The Office of The Chief Army Reserve Force Management is responsible to fully develop Force Structure requirements, conduct Force Integration of organizational designs and plans, and conduct Force Accounting and Allocation of authorizations to provide the Army Reserve Commanders with a more accessible and readily deployable force. Apogee Solutions supports the Force Management (FM) process through reviews, studies, analysis, assessments, and functional expertise, encompassing conceptual development, capabilities requirements generation, Force Development, Organizational Development, Force Integration Functions, and Force Accounting of resources within the Department of Defense.
